Maureen Wroblewitz says goodbye to beauty pageants? ‘It’s not really my priority’

After winning first-runner up to Miss Universe Philippines winner Beatrice Luigi Gomez in 2021, model and actress Maureen Wroblewitz has been keeping busy shuttling to and from the US and the Philippines every few months to work on various projects.

Earlier this year, she starred in her first international film called Take Me to Banaue and she also became a Levi’s 501 campaign ambassador in the country.

The 24-year-old Fil-German beauty revealed that unlike other candidates, she has no immediate plans to join another local pageant any time soon.

“Probably not (laughs). I don’t know. I’m turning 25 so I still have a little more time but as of now, it’s not part of my plan. It’s definitely a time of experience and self-discovery, self-love, prioritizing my peace and getting to know myself better.

“As of now, it’s not really my priority. But of course I watched it I was very supportive of the girls there. But it’s not really part of my plan right now. But it doesn’t have to be not my plan at all. I never know if I change my mind,” she admitted.

Maureen shared how happy she was when her fellow beauty queens won, like Miss Universe Philippines 2023 Michelle Dee and Miss Supranational Philippines 2023 Pauline Amelinckx.
Maureen shared how happy she was when her fellow beauty queens won, like Miss Universe Philippines 2023 Michelle Dee and Miss Supranational Philippines 2023 Pauline Amelinckx.
“Oh my gosh I was really rooting for both of them. But Michelle is very deserving. Both of them are very deserving. So I’m really glad. I watched them last year and they’ve grown so much in the past year so I’m very, very happy for both of them, Miss Supra and Miss Universe Philippines. They’re both very deserving,” she said.

Having experienced being scrutinized by netizens after being in the spotlight during the beauty pageant, Maureen shared what advice she can give to those going through the same thing this year.

“It really affects your mental health. You get a lot of comparisons to a lot of girls and they look at your body. They don’t really look at who you are inside. So of course you have to take care of yourself as well if this is what they see. But they should not just look at your face but who you are as a person and what are your intentions, are they good intentions or what is your purpose in joining?” she explained.

Unlike other beauty queens who are always seen looking glamorous and made up, Maureen said she is most comfortable in casual wear and prefers to wear jeans and a simple top when not at work.

“The reason why I joined at my time is because I saw the beauty pageant industry was changing. It was more of ‘We want to see who you are as a person, like your authentic self’ and I’ve always been the type of person like me before I would always need to be dressed up, look good, wear makeup and I didn’t like that. Because it’s not realistic.

“We have days where we want to just go out without makeup, wear casual clothes, and at the time when I joined, I was already seeing how that changed. And I love that I was able to be part of that change and to tell other people that beauty queens are human beings too and that we want to be more approachable. We want to be able to help and I think showing that you are a real human being and that you can have bad days and good days, it gets you closer to the community and to the Filipino people,” she shared.
